Thông số kỹ thuật
| thuộc tính | Giá trị |
| Series | PTH05050W (21W) |
| PartStatus | Obsolete |
| Type | Non-Isolated PoL Module |
| NumberofOutputs | 1 |
| Voltage-Input(Min) | 4.5V |
| Voltage-Input(Max) | 5.5V |
| Voltage-Output1 | 0.8 ~ 3.6V |
| Current-Output(Max) | 6A |
| Applications | ITE (Commercial) |
| Features | Remote On/Off, OCP, UVLO |
| OperatingTemperature | -40°C ~ 85°C |
| Efficiency | 95% |
| MountingType | Surface Mount |
| Package/Case | 6-SMD Module |
| Size/Dimension | 0.87" L x 0.50" W x 0.34" H (22.1mm x 12.7mm x 8.6mm) |
| BaseProductNumber | PTH05050 |
| Power(Watts) | 21 W |

Description
Key features of the PTH05050WAZ include a wide input voltage range, typically around 4.5V to 5.5V, and an adjustable output voltage range, generally from 0.8V to 3.6V. It delivers a maximum output current of 6A, making it suitable for moderate power applications. The module is known for its high efficiency, often over 90%, minimizing power loss and heat generation.
The PTH05050WAZ is designed for ease of use, with features such as overcurrent protection, thermal shutdown, and an adjustable output to suit different requirements. Its compact size and efficient performance make it popular in applications like telecommunications, networking equipment, and consumer electronics, where space and power efficiency are critical.

Features
1. Wide Input Voltage Range: Operates typically from 4.5V to 5.5V, adaptable for a variety of applications.
2. Adjustable Output Voltage: Offers adjustable output, generally ranging from 0.8V to 3.6V, allowing flexibility in various electronic designs.
3. High Efficiency: Capable of delivering high efficiency, often exceeding 90%, which helps in reducing power loss and thermal management issues.
4. Output Current: Supports up to 6A of output current, making it suitable for moderate power applications.
5. Compact Size: The module is compact, aiding in space-constrained designs.
6. Over-Current Protection: Features integrated over-current protection, enhancing reliability by preventing damage from overload conditions.
7. Thermal Shutdown: Equipped with thermal shutdown capability to protect the module from overheating.
8. Soft Start: Includes a soft-start function to minimize inrush current during startup.
These features make it a versatile and reliable choice for powering various digital circuits and systems.
